James J. Kriva

James J. Kriva is a senior shareholder with Kasdorf, Lewis & Swietlik, S.C. He represents Corporations, Insurers and Individuals in state and federal court civil litigation including trials and arbitration practice. He has handled a wide range of lawsuits and legal disputes with emphasis on product liability litigation, fire and gas explosion litigation, farm litigation, commercial contract litigation, and general liability and negligence lawsuits. Mr. Kriva's professional practice regularly includes complex litigation, technical issues litigation and catastrophic loss litigation.

Mr. Kriva has defended and prosecuted more than 150 fire cases, including large fire losses involving multi million dollar damage claims, and gas and chemical explosion losses. Additionally, he has handled over 250 product liability cases involving a wide variety of mechanical, electrical and chemical product defect claims and failure-to-warn product liability lawsuits.

Mr. Kriva was born in Washington, D.C. in 1953 and was raised in Wisconsin. He is a 1975 graduate of Lawrence University and a 1978 graduate of the University of Wisconsin Law School. He joined Kasdorf, Lewis & Swietlik in 1981, became a shareholder in 1987, and has served as chair of the law firm’s Management Committee since 1998. Mr. Kriva is admitted to practice before all state and federal Wisconsin trial and appellate courts, the Menominee tribal court, and various Midwestern state and federal courts. Mr. Kriva holds the highest AV legal ability rating with Martindale-Hubbell. He is a member of the State Bar of Wisconsin and Civil Trial Counsel of Wisconsin. He is a Fellow in the Litigation Counsel of America, a Trial Lawyer Honorary Society with invited membership limited to the top one-half of 1% of actively practicing American lawyers.
